This past weekend I had a great time co-hosting my first G-Star RAW Night.
RAW Nights give G-Star the chance to bring the essence of what the brand is to life. They take over a location somewhere in the world and turn it into something totally different. G-Star is very much involved in the art and film world and photography and all sorts of creative arts and they use an event like this to present talent from all of these areas in a ‘live’ setting.
The transformation of these venues into something more unexpected, combined with the mix of live performance, art and music, allows guests to experience what G-Star’s clothing collections are all about.  They have used many different platforms  like 3301 Raw Records, Raw Rhythm Festival, Raw Gallery and RAW Nights (all on the G Star website). Previous hosts for these incredible G-star nights have included the Japanese photographer and artist, Hiromix, in Tokyo; the Oscar-nominated actor and artist, Dennis Hopper, in LA; and even the U.N. at the event in New York.
For our event, we took over an amazing old church in Mayfair and transformed it into a mixture of an art gallery, DJ stage, party and live art; combining so many of the things I’m passionate about. The incredible photographer, Anton Corbijn, who has shot all of the G-Star campaigns so far, displayed over 300 of his unseen work.  Being a massive fan of his, these pictures blew my mind!  The brilliant graffiti artist Fin DAC (Beautiful Crime) – a friend of mine – did a live art show (of a campaign image) and I was so excited about the XX,  one of my favourite bands at the moment, who DJed.  The crowd were cool and typically ‘London’ and the party was a great success!
